hey just recently signed up after deciding to take my curiosity of collecting autographs into overdrive and decided that i should get pro-active and actually start collecting them,
after browsing through your wonderful site i have noticed that many of you prefer to send your own pics to be signed (which makes a lot of sense because then you can choose what film you want a pic of them from or find a cool onstage pose for musicians etc .. ) but i have a question .. and this may be a really stupid question but where do you get all these pics you are sending away to celebrities?
do you find them via Google Images and just print them off the internet or what?? any help would be much appreciated

It doesn't really matter how to print them, I think most people just print them off with higher quality paper or go to the local print shop for the best quality. You can also buy good quality photos online. I have a photo printer so I find a good quality picture online and print it out
If you're going to print it yourself, when you're searching for your image e.g. on Google, on the size options you should select "Extra Large Images" or "Large Images". This will narrow down your search but give you the best quality of pictures. Small pictures may come out a bit grainy.

hi i usualy send my own images , i get them off of google images and sometimes i get pictures off fan sites. i always use regular paper but the photos look fine and theirs no problem getting a signature on the photo( its similar to getting a note pad signed ). also index cards are awsome items to send its like a dollar for a pack of 50, their sturdy extremly cheap,and signatures look great on them.
the reason i like to send my own photos is because its a postage issue. i feel if im asking a celebrity for their photo then i dont know what size sase im going to have to send and how many stamps im going to have to put(so im going to have send a 8x10 envelope put two 96 cent stamps on them then send the almost 3 dollars for one letter,but if i send my own photo i can send a standard envelope and put one stamp on it and its less then 2 dollars im saving a dollar per letter),now if i send my own photo then i know exactly how big the photo is and how big the envelope should be and how much postage will be.
also even asking the celebrity to sign your letter can be nice, the way i see it is, you and the celebrity both have your signatures on that item.
ps a sase if you dont know what it is, its a return envelope you send to the celebrity you put your adress and name on it and a stamp and you include it with your letter, so the celebrity doesent have to pay for any postage.
and btw saving a extra 96 cents per letter adds up(like i mentioned its almost a dollar per letter which makes a big difference in the long run). but yes their are times thou ive had to send big envelopes which ive gladly done it and ive gotten some real nice photos back from celebs.
and also if you print out your own photos you can make collages and get a collage signed(you can make them the normal way by cutting and pasting photos or make them on the computer) collages look amazing signed, ive gotten a few back. also a lyric sheet to a song would be nice also(if your writing a singer, but if you do send obviously your going to send one of their songs) so ya.
